I have just puchased a new laptop with vista ultimate. As yet I have not been
able to get file sharing to work between the vista laptop and the xp pro laptop. Both are connected via wireless through a netgear router. In vista the network is set to private, networt discovery is on, file sharing is on, password protected sharing is off. No other firewall is on both machines other than windows firewall. On the vista machine I can only see the xp machine media device not the computer. On the xp machine I cannot see anything in the workgroup. I have tried installing network magic on both but still cannot access shared folders as it comes up with a error shared folder not available informing me that it is a firewall issue. |

Do you have any third party security products at all? Some antivirus packages contains antiworm components that act as a firewall, and block SMBs (blocked SMBs is your basic problem). http://nitecruzr.blogspot.com/2005/05/your-personal-firewall-can-either-help.html http://nitecruzr.blogspot.com/2005/0...ther-help.html Is the NetBT setting consistent for both computers? http://nitecruzr.blogspot.com/2006/07/advanced-windows-networking-using.html http://nitecruzr.blogspot.com/2006/0...ing-using.html -- Cheers, Chuck, MS-MVP 2005-2007 [Windows - Networking] http://nitecruzr.blogspot.com/ Paranoia is not a problem, when it's a normal response from experience. This problem has now been solved.
It was the xp machine that was not enabling netBIOS even if it was set enabled. It was solved by uninstalling tcp/ip protocol and reinstalling it.
